How to Send Goods to Onitsha From Abroad
Start by providing the important details about your shipment. These usually include:
- Overseas pickup address
- Delivery address in Onitsha
- Description of the goods
- Number of packages
- Weight and dimensions
- Recipient’s name and phone number
- Preferred delivery timeframe
The information helps determine the appropriate freight and delivery arrangements.
Air or Sea Freight to Onitsha?
The best option depends on the size of your shipment, budget and urgency.
Air freight is generally more suitable for smaller or urgent shipments such as electronics, clothes, documents, gifts and smaller quantities of business goods.
Sea freight can be more practical for bulky or heavy shipments where speed is less important. This may include furniture, household belongings, machinery and larger quantities of commercial stock.
If you are buying from several suppliers abroad, consolidation can also be useful for combining shipments before they are transported to Nigeria.
What Happens When the Goods Arrive in Nigeria?
International shipments may require customs documentation, inspection, duty payment and cargo clearance before they can be released for local delivery.
Once the shipment is cleared, the goods can be moved from the port or other Nigerian arrival point toward Onitsha.
For larger shipments, proper haulage planning is particularly important because the cargo may need to travel from Lagos or another arrival point to Onitsha before reaching the final recipient.

How Much Does It Cost to Send Goods to Onitsha?
There is no single price for international shipping to Onitsha. The cost can depend on the country of origin, weight, dimensions, type of goods, shipping method, customs requirements and final delivery arrangements.
A small parcel sent by air will cost differently from several cartons or a large commercial shipment sent by sea.
For an accurate quote, provide the actual cargo details rather than relying on a general price per kilogram.

Sending Business Goods to Onitsha
Onitsha is an important commercial centre, so businesses may regularly need to move imported stock into the city.
A typical shipment can involve:
- Overseas supplier prepares the goods.
- Goods are collected or delivered to the freight facility.
- Air or sea freight is arranged.
- Cargo is transported to Nigeria.
- Customs requirements are completed.
- Cargo is released.
- Transport is arranged to Onitsha.
- Goods are delivered to the shop, warehouse or business address.
For businesses importing regularly, warehousing and fulfilment can also help with storing and distributing stock.

What to Confirm Before Shipping
Before sending your goods, confirm:
- Whether the items are permitted
- Exact weight and dimensions
- Air or sea freight options
- Customs and import requirements
- Packaging requirements
- Expected delivery timeframe
- Total international and local delivery costs
- Correct Onitsha delivery address and phone number
Having accurate information from the beginning can help reduce delays, unexpected charges and delivery problems.
